cdn防御_高级防御
cdn防御_高级防御

内容分发网络(CDN)是一种分布式系统,旨在通过在多个地理位置缓存网站内容来加快内容的传送速度,除了提高网站的加载速度外,CDN还提供了多种安全功能,帮助抵御针对网站的恶意攻击,本文将详细探讨CDN的高级防御机制。
基础防御机制
了解基础防御机制是理解高级防御的前提,CDN的基础防御通常包括:
负载均衡:分散流量至多个服务器,避免单点故障。
DDoS保护:自动识别并缓解分布式拒绝服务攻击。
SSL/TLS加密:保护传输中的数据不被窃取或篡改。
Web应用防火墙(WAF):过滤有害的HTTP请求,如SQL注入、跨站脚本攻击等。
高级防御技术
在基础防御之上,高级防御技术进一步加固网络安全,以下是一些常见的高级防御措施:
智能调度系统
智能调度系统可以实时监控各地节点的流量和健康状况,一旦检测到异常流量,系统会立即调整路由策略,将流量导向较少负荷的节点,从而有效分散攻击流量,保护源站不受影响。
多层防护架构
多层防护架构通过在不同网络层次实施安全策略,为网站提供全方位的保护,在网络层部署入侵检测系统(IDS),在应用层部署WAF,以及在数据层进行加密和访问控制。
自适应速率限制
自适应速率限制根据历史数据和行为分析,动态调整用户访问频率的限制,这有助于防止自动化攻击,如爬虫和暴力破解尝试。
边缘计算与响应
利用CDN的边缘节点进行数据处理和响应,可以减少对中心服务器的依赖,这不仅提高了处理速度,也减少了中心服务器面临的安全威胁。
零时差攻击防护
通过持续更新的威胁情报和自动化的安全补丁部署,CDN能够快速响应新出现的攻击手段,实现零时差攻击防护。
机器学习与人工智能
结合机器学习和人工智能技术,CDN可以更准确地识别和响应安全威胁,这些技术可以帮助预测攻击模式,自动调整防御策略。
防御效果评估
为了确保高级防御措施的有效性,定期进行防御效果评估是必要的,评估通常包括:
性能监控:监测CDN的响应时间和可用性。
安全事件日志:审查安全事件日志,分析攻击类型和防御效果。
模拟攻击测试:定期进行模拟攻击,检验防御体系的弹性。
合规性检查:确保CDN符合行业标准和法规要求。
相关问答FAQs
Q1: CDN能否完全阻止所有的DDoS攻击?
A1: 没有任何一种防御机制能够保证完全阻止所有的DDoS攻击,通过结合多种高级防御技术,CDN可以大幅度降低攻击成功的可能性,并减轻攻击造成的影响。
Q2: 如何选择合适的CDN服务提供商?
A2: 选择合适的CDN服务提供商时,应考虑以下因素:服务商的安全特性、服务质量、价格、客户支持、以及是否提供定制化服务,查看服务商的案例研究和客户评价也很重要。
通过上述高级防御技术的应用,CDN不仅能够加速内容的分发,还能显著提升网站的安全性能,随着网络攻击手段的不断进化,CDN的安全功能也在不断升级和完善,以应对日益复杂的网络安全挑战。